Peno Township, Pike County, Missouri

Last updated

Peno Township is an inactive township in Pike County, in the U.S. state of Missouri. [1]

Peno Township was erected in 1819, taking its name from Peno Creek. [2]

Peno Creek is a stream in the Pike County in northeastern Missouri. The stream headwaters are north of U. S. Route 54 just west of Bowling Green. The stream flows northwest paralleling U. S. Route 61 then passes under Route 61 south of Frankford and continues north to northeast until reaching its confluence with the Salt River just south of the Pike-Ralls county line.
